- PHRASAL VERB 恢复;复原;重整旗鼓
If youbounce backafter a bad experience, you return very quickly to your previous level of success, enthusiasm, or activity.- We lost two or three early games in the World Cup, but we bounced back...
在世界杯比赛开始时我们有两三场比赛失利,但后来我们又恢复了状态。 - He is young enough to bounce back from this disappointment.
他还年轻,会很快从失望沮丧中恢复过来的。
